The proper register for multicolor printing, that is, the printing of as many as five colors on top of one another to the required accuracy of a few thousandths of an inch, has been successfully solved by the use of phototubes and associated electronic equipment. In the system described, the electronic portion extends all the way from the phototubes to the thyratrons which supply the required current to energize the correcting motor armature in the proper direction and at the speed for correct register.
